Santa Clara, California, April 17, 2018 -- Sify Technologies Limited (NASDAQ NM: SIFY), headquartered at Chennai India, India’s leading Data Center, Cloud, Telecom and Managed Services provider with global delivery capabilities, today announced that it will report its unaudited IFRS financial results for the full year ended March 31, 2018 on Tuesday, April 24, 2018 before the market opens.
In conjunction with the announcement, Sify will host a conference call at 8:30 AM ET with Mr. Raju Vegesna, Chairman of the Board, Mr. Kamal Nath, Chief Executive Officer and Mr. M P Vijay Kumar, Chief Financial Officer. About Sify Technologies:
Sify is the largest ICT service provider, system integrator and all-in-one network solutions company on the Indian subcontinent. We’ve also expanded to the United States, with headquarters in the heart of California’s Silicon Valley.
Over 8500 businesses have become Sify customers. We also partner with other major network operators to deliver global network solutions. Our customers can access Sify services via India’s largest MPLS network. Among the very few Enterprise class players in India, Sify, today has presence in more than 1550 cities in India and in North America, the United Kingdom and Singapore.
